California Guide
California's 840-mile coastline offers some of the most dramatic wedding backdrops on earth. Big Sur's 90-mile stretch of Pacific coastline features towering cliffs, ancient redwood forests, and golden-hour light that photographers travel the world to capture. Morning fog common June through August lifts by afternoon — plan ceremonies for late afternoon when the coastal light is at its most spectacular. Sunset in fall: around 6:30 PM with the clearest skies of the year.
Santa Barbara, known as the "American Riviera," combines Mediterranean architecture with year-round sunshine — averaging 283 sunny days per year. The Santa Barbara County Courthouse Sunken Gardens and Mural Room are among the most iconic ceremony venues in the state, with Spanish Colonial architecture and ocean views. The surrounding area offers both grand venues (San Ysidro Ranch, Rosewood Miramar Beach, The Ritz-Carlton Bacara) and intimate settings along Butterfly Beach in Montecito and Leadbetter Beach downtown.
For couples wanting a wine country wedding, Santa Barbara's Santa Ynez Valley and surrounding ranch properties offer vineyard-backdrop ceremonies just 30 minutes from the coast. The combination of ocean, mountains, and vineyards within a short drive is uniquely Santa Barbara.
